River accident in Germany leaves 11 injured

Eleven people were injured when a barge collided with a ferry on the Elbe River in Hamburg, Germany, Report informs via Bild.
The incident occurred at 06:43 (GMT+1). The ferry had 25 people on board, and the condition of one victim is reportedly serious.
Preliminary information suggests that the barge broke away from its mooring for an unknown reason.
